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Frontegg

  • Detailed per-unit pricing beyond the free tier is not published, requiring use of an online calculator or sales contact to estimate costs.
  • Advanced fraud protection and multiple environments are Enterprise-only, unavailable on the Pay As You Go plan.
  • The 7,500 free monthly active users is comparatively modest next to some competitors' free tiers.
  • As a broader CIAM platform, it can be more complex to integrate than lighter-weight developer-first auth tools for smaller apps.

Kubernetes

  • Complex initial setup and configuration with multiple interdependent components
  • Significant resource requirements for both hardware infrastructure and specialized human expertise
  • Expensive specialized talent in Kubernetes domain; hiring costs prohibitive for many organizations
  • New security challenges around container isolation and network security requiring robust measures
  • Requires continuous maintenance and updates to stay current with releases and security patches

Answered from the vendors’ own pages

Frontegg: What does Frontegg cost?

Frontegg's Pay As You Go plan is free up to 7,500 monthly active users, after which pricing scales with users, enterprise connections and M2M tokens via an online calculator; Enterprise pricing is custom.

Kubernetes: What is Kubernetes used for?

Kubernetes is a container orchestration platform that automates deployment, scaling, and management of containerized applications across clusters of machines.

Frontegg: Is there a free plan and what are its limits?

Yes, the free Pay As You Go plan includes 7,500 monthly active users, 5 enterprise SSO/SCIM connections, unlimited organizations, and a custom domain.

Kubernetes: Is Kubernetes free?

Yes, Kubernetes is free, open-source software maintained by the Cloud Native Computing Foundation. However, running Kubernetes clusters requires infrastructure investment.

Frontegg: How is usage metered?

Pricing is consumption-based, driven by monthly active users, monthly enterprise connections (SSO/SCIM), and monthly M2M tokens, with customers paying only for usage beyond the free 7,500-user threshold.

Kubernetes: How hard is it to learn Kubernetes?

Kubernetes has a steep learning curve. It requires deep knowledge of containerization, networking, and distributed systems. Teams without prior container experience should expect significant training time.
